They're easy to train
German Shepherds are highly intelligent dogs that respond well to reward-based training. This makes them easy to train and an excellent option for those who are new to the breed. However, they need consistency and ongoing training to prevent reverting to bad behaviour. They are also very energetic and need a lot of physical exercise. If you don't have enough time to take them on walks or play with them and your German Shepherd could get bored and develop behavioral problems.

They're big dogs
German Shepherds can reach a weight of 75 to 95 pounds when they reach full maturity. They have a thick double coat that can be wavy or straight, and they shed year-round. Brushing your dog every other day will help keep shedding at the minimum. You can make use of a deshedding tool or slickerbrush, depending on what kind of coat your pet's coat is.
